cheese taster

human history
  • Ingoa Kē

    cheese taster made from shinbone of a sheep, displayed at Melbourne Exhibition (descriptive name)

  • Kupu whakaahua

    cheese taster / cheese trier, bone, long hollowed scoop form with carved knuckle bone finial, simple carved geometric pattern to lower half of finial.
